Herbert Aptheker

53 books

296 pages hardcover 2006

challenging informative reflective medium-paced

288 pages paperback

nonfiction classics essays history literary

371 pages hardcover 1989

medium-paced

158 pages paperback 1965 user-added

nonfiction essays philosophy politics

128 pages paperback 1966 user-added

nonfiction

missing page info 1966

dark reflective medium-paced

166 pages 1966

nonfiction history race dark reflective medium-paced

missing page info 1966

dark reflective medium-paced

176 pages 1966

nonfiction history race challenging informative reflective slow-paced

128 pages 1981

challenging informative reflective medium-paced